What Paint Is Best To Hide Imperfections. It's all in the flick of a brush, rag or roller, and the finish of the paint you use. Lighter colors tend to be more forgiving when it comes to hiding imperfections. When choosing a paint finish, the best choice for hiding imperfections is a flat finish such as matte, eggshell, or satin. Selecting the best paint to hide imperfections is crucial for achieving flawless walls. Latex paint this is the most popular choice for interior paint and is also the most environmentally friendly. The matte finish will easily disguise any dents or uneven surfaces. What paint color hides the most imperfections? Flat paint is the best choice to hide imperfections on your walls!
